stop up

Dictionary

verb

  • To fill a hole or cavity, or block an opening or passage, as with a plug.
  • To increase the aperture of a photographic lens, moving from an f/stop represented by a higher number to an f/stop represented by a lower number and causing more light to pass into the camera.
